On June 15, 2026, travelers at Chicago-area airports encountered widespread disruptions as around 340 flights were delayed and 20 were canceled. Major carriers including American Airlines, SkyWest, and United Airlines were among those impacted by this extensive scale of delays and cancellations.
Flight services affected a broad range of routes spanning the United States, Canada, Mexico, the United Kingdom, France, Germany, and other destinations. These interruptions resulted in hundreds of passengers being stranded in the Chicago area, generating considerable travel challenges for those attempting to reach both domestic and international locations.
